What is energy storage system?
The energy-storage system consists of supercapacitors and a bi-directional DC/DC conversion circuit. According to the state of the metro train’s operation, the storage system can be controlled to inject or absorb energy, thereby stabilizing the DC busbar and compensating for energy deficiencies.
What are the benefits of storing energy in Metro stations?
In turn the stored energy could power upon demand selected stationary electrical loads in Metro stations of a non-safety critical character (such as lighting, ventilation, pumps, etc.) leading to very significant energy savings and to a corresponding reduction of greenhouse gases.
Does a stationary hybrid energy storage system work in Metro traction substations?
This paper focuses on the configuration of a stationary hybrid energy storage system, located in metro traction substations in turn located inside Metro stations. The recuperation energy of the metro braking phase is then reused to feed stationary electrical loads of metro stations.
What is a hybrid energy storage system?
A hybrid Energy Storage System termed MetroHESS foresees the storage and reuse of regenerative train braking energy through an active combination of batteries covering base power electrical consumer loads in Metro stations and supercapacitors able to receive the energy power peaks from train braking.
How regenerative energy can be stored in a metro train?
If there is a high power demand from the low-voltage loads, regenerative energy produced by the metro train could be preferentially fed back to the AC 400 V grid to meet the demand. On the other hand, if the demand is low, the energy could be stored by a device such as a supercapacitor.
